Barley Agronomy Specialist (Northern Region)

Job Purpose

To ensure consistent, high-quality barley production in the Northern region by supporting farmers to achieve optimal yield, quality, and supply targets aligned with the company’s sourcing strategy.


Key Responsibilities

Farmer Mobilization & Support

  • Mobilize, recruit, and register barley farmers within the assigned region
  • Coach farmers to manage farming operations as sustainable and profitable businesses
  • Promote adoption of mechanization (e.g., planters, threshers, harvesting equipment)

Crop Production & Agronomy

  • Ensure timely land preparation, planting, weeding, and harvesting
  • Enforce recommended agronomic practices
  • Promote soil fertility management, moisture conservation, and crop rotation
  • Ensure use of certified barley seed supplied by the company at correct seed rates

Crop Monitoring & Advisory

  • Monitor crop performance throughout the growth cycle
  • Identify pests, diseases, and abnormalities, and advise on corrective actions
  • Ensure proper and timely application of herbicides, fungicides, and insecticides

Planning & Resource Management

  • Identify and verify acreage and input requirements
  • Maintain accurate records of farmer data, input distribution, acreage, and yields
  • Assist in recovery of input costs advanced to farmers

Reporting & Digital Tools

  • Prepare and submit timely monthly reports, including sustainability and production metrics
  • Utilize digital tools for accurate reporting of agronomic and non-agronomic data
  • Disseminate improved farming technologies and agronomic best practices
